A S0C4 or U3002 abend can result in the COBOL compile (IGYCRCTL) in an Endevor processor.
This can happen if SIZE compile option is not specified selected. The resolution is to specify SIZE(####). If no SIZE is referenced, the default is MAX, which uses all below the line storage.
In Enterprise COBOL V5.1, the SIZE option value is no longer an upper-limit for the total storage used by a COBOL compilation. In addition, the SIZE suboption value MAX is no longer supported. The default value for the SIZE option is SIZE(5000000).
From Enterprise COBOL V5.2, the SIZE option has been removed.
